Introduction
The Full Court of the Federal Court of Australia (Justices Beach, Jackson and Jackman) has issued a further, and what appears to be the final, decision in the long-running litigation between Nalco Company (Nalco) and Cytec Industries Inc (Cytec). The litigation relates to Nalco’s patent application AU2012220990 entitled “Reducing aluminosilicate scale in the Bayer process” (the 990 Application).
The Full Court decision upholds the primary judge’s decision on the opposition to grant of the 990 Application, but overrules the primary judge’s decision on Nalco’s amendment application. So, Nalco’s persistence has finally paid off, with the 990 Application now ready to proceed to grant.
The decision provides important guidance on claim construction in chemical patent cases, the interaction between support and sufficiency under s 40 of the Patents Act 1990 (Cth) (the Act), and the Court’s approach to amendments to patent applications under s 105(1A) of the Act following adverse validity findings.
Background
990 Application
The 990 Application claims a method for reducing “desilication product” (DSP) scale by adding a composition which consists of specific silane-based small molecules (non-polymeric, low molecular weight compounds) to the process stream developed by Karl Bayer (the Bayer Process). These silane-based small molecules are said to offer advantages of better diffusion, more active inhibiting moieties per unit, and lower viscosity.
The Bayer Process represented the industry-standard for extracting alumina from bauxite ore. A significant operational problem was the formation of aluminosilicate DSP scale inside process equipment, which adversely affected the efficiency of the plant’s equipment, and required acid-based descaling. One prior art solution developed and marketed by Cytec under the name “Max HT” comprised an oxysilane-based anti-scalant additive that would keep the silica in solution and prevent scale formation.
The claims of the 990 Application identify specific silane-based small molecules by structural diagrams (denoted by Roman numerals), all formed within a complex product mixture resulting from the reaction of particular chemical reagents (amines, 3-glycidoxypropyltrimethoxysilane, 2-ethylhexyl glycidyl ether).
Claim 1 specifically provided:
(1) A method for the reduction of aluminosilicate containing scale in a Bayer process comprising the step of:
(2) adding to the Bayer process stream an aluminosilicate scale inhibiting amount of a composition comprising at least one small molecule
(3) selected from the group consisting of compounds (I) through (XIII), (XV) through (XXX), (XXXII) through (XLVII), (LIII) through (LVIII) and (LX)
(4) within a product mixture formed from the reaction of a) hexane diamine, ethylene diamine or 1-amino-2-propanol; b) 3-glycidoxypropyltrimethoxysilane; and c) 2-ethylhexyl glycidyl ether:
[drawn thereafter are the 46 further compounds referred to in integer (3)]
Critically, integer (4) of claim 1 listed three constituent reactants from which the product mixture had to be formed:
(1) hexane diamine (HD), ethylene diamine (ED) or 1-amino-2-propanol (AP), being amines (A);
(2) 3-glycidoxypropyltrimethoxysilane (GPS) being an amine-reactive compound that has a silane (Si(OR)3) group; and
(3) 2-ethylhexyl glycidyl ether (E) being an amine-reactive hydrophobic hydrocarbon.
Procedural History
The case had a complex procedural history. After Nalco filed its patent application in February 2012, it faced opposition from Cytec in August 2015. What followed was a series of amendment attempts and opposition proceedings before the Patent Office, eventually leading to Federal Court proceedings. As previously reported, in August 2021, Justice Burley found that the claims lacked support and sufficient disclosure, but rejected Cytec’s submissions in respect of lack of novelty or best method (the Substantive Decision). In response, Nalco filed further amendment applications aimed at overcoming the lack of support and sufficient disclosure findings, culminating in its sixth proposed amendment application including, amongst other proposed amendments, the following proposed amendments to claim 1 shown in mark-up:
(1) A method for the reduction of aluminosilicate containing scale in a Bayer process comprising the steps of:
(2) adding to the Bayer process stream an aluminosilicate scale inhibiting amount of a composition comprising at least one small molecules is selected from the group consisting of compounds:
(3) (I) through (IX), (XXVIII) (XIII), (XV) through (XXX) and (XXXII) through (XLVII), (LIII)through (LVIII) and (LX)
(4) within a product mixture formed from the reaction of a) hexane diamine, ethylene diamine or1-amino-2-propanol; b) 3-glycdixoypropyltrimethoxysilane; and c) 2-ethylhexyl glycidyl ether:
[drawn thereafter are the 12 further compounds referred to in integer (3)].
As we previously reported, Justice Burley refused Nalco’s sixth proposed amendment application in his November 2024 decision (the Amendment Decision).
Nalco sought leave and was granted leave to appeal both the Substantive and Amendment Decisions.
Appeal from the Substantive Decision
The key issues in this appeal revolved around the correct construction of unamended claim 1, and the implications of this construction for the issues of support and sufficient disclosure.
In upholding Justice Burley’s Substantive Decision, the Full Bench agreed with Justice Burley that:
Construction
- Properly construed, unamended claim 1 included within its scope both:
- a complex reaction mixture, formed from the reaction of A + GPS + E, that included within it many of the identified small molecules as well as many more compounds; and
- a reaction mixture, formed from the reaction of A + GPS + E, that was made up of a single type of small molecule identified in the claim.
Justice Burley considered this to be the proper construction because of the use of the language “comprising at least one small molecule” which indicated that the claim covered the spectrum between these two possibilities.
- The evidence was not that it was scientifically impossible to have a composition comprising only one single type of small molecule or only specified small molecules. Rather, there was no known way of making such a composition. It was in principle possible but statistically very unlikely that such a composition would result from simply reacting the precursor molecules with each other as described.
- There was no evidence that a composition comprising a single type of small molecule would not work in the claimed method.
Support
- The 990 Application did not identify or describe the beneficial effects of particular small molecules. The 990 Application also did not identify or describe how to produce a reaction mixture that consisted of only one or other of those small molecules.
- Accordingly, to the extent that unamended claim 1 included a reaction product mixture containing only particular small molecules identified in the claim, that aspect of the claim was not supported. However, the broader embodiment encompassed within the claim, where the reaction product is a complex mixture containing many of the listed small molecules and many more compounds, did not suffer from lack of support.
Sufficiency
- For the same reasons as unamended claim 1 lacked support, the disclosure of the 990 Application was not sufficient to enable the invention claimed to be performed without undue experimentation to the extent that those claims included a product mixture made up of a single type of small molecule.
Appeal from the Amendment Decision
The key issues in this appeal again revolved around the correct construction of claim 1 (but now in its proposed amended form), and the implications of this construction for the allowability of the amendments. Cytec argued that amended claim 1 still encompassed product mixtures containing only the listed small molecules, and that as a result, the amendments were not allowable because, amongst other things, the amended claim 1 would lack support and clarity and that the 990 Application (as proposed to be amended) did not provide a clear enough and complete enough disclosure for the invention to be performed by a person skilled in the art.
At first instance, Justice Burley agreed with Cytec’s construction, finding that, while the claims required all specified small molecules to be present, they did not require the presence of additional molecules – more may be included, but were not essential. Justice Burley also rejected Nalco’s argument based on “practical impossibility”, noting that the claims should be understood according to their terms, and not by reference to technical limitations or practical impossibilities. As a result, his Honour considered that amended claim 1 still encompassed product mixtures containing only the specified molecules without providing sufficient technical disclosure to support such claims and without providing a clear enough and complete enough disclosure for the invention to be performed by a person skilled in the art.
Justices Beach and Jackman (with Justice Jackson dissenting), however, disagreed with Justice Burley. In overturning Justice Burley’s Amendment Decision, Justices Beach and Jackman stated that:
- The words “at least one” and “selected from” had been removed from claim 1, such that the composition now comprised the identified small molecules within a product mixture formed from the reaction of A, GPS and E.
- As a matter of ordinary English, the fact that the identified small molecules are “within” a product mixture meant that the product mixture is a complex mixture that includes but is not limited to the identified small molecules.
- The claims do not include within their scope a product mixture made up of only the identified small molecules and nothing else.
- The claims must be construed in the context of the common general knowledge which included knowledge that:
- when one of the three different forms of A was reacted with GPS and E, the resulting product mixture would always contain an extremely large variety of small molecules which included all of the small molecules listed in the amended and unamended claims, as well as many others, as well as polymers; and
- it was not practically possible to react A, GPS and E in a way that results in only those small molecules being present to the exclusion of other small molecules or polymers.
- Accordingly, the skilled addressee would not think that the claims are directed to anything other than a product mixture that includes small molecules.
- Given this construction, amended claim 1 does not lack support and clarity and the 990 Application (as proposed to be amended) does provide a clear enough and complete enough disclosure for the invention to be performed by a person skilled in the art.
Discretion under s 105(1A)
Cytec also contended that the proposed amendments should be refused on discretionary grounds under s 105(1A) of the Act for reasons related to alleged delay and misconduct in seeking the amendments.
Relevantly, Justices Beach and Jackman considered that the rationale underlying the Court’s discretion to refuse amendments to a granted patent under s 105(1) was not a rationale that could simply be applied to the power of amendment to a patent application under s 105(1A). In particular, unlike with a granted patent, a patent application did not give rise to a monopoly and so no abuse of monopoly could arise.
Having found the amendments allowable, Justices Beach and Jackman addressed the issue of discretion. The key factors included:
- Delay: Cytec argued that Nalco had been on notice of support/sufficiency vulnerabilities since at least 2016 and deliberately delayed filing amendments (including the “third amendments” in 2018) to tactically disadvantage Cytec. Justices Beach and Jackman found that the 2018 conduct (which concerned different amendments addressing a different issue — the isolation of individual small molecules) was not causally connected to the amendments now sought. Since the successful support/sufficiency grounds were first raised by Cytec only on the eve of trial in October 2020, in substantially amended form, their Honours found that Nalco had reasonable grounds to believe amendments were unnecessary while it maintained a tenable construction. As such, Justices Beach and Jackman did not consider that Nalco had unreasonably delayed in seeking to make the amendments. Further, if there had been any delay, such delay had not caused any significant and relevant prejudice to Cytec.
- Full and frank disclosure: Justices Beach and Jackman found Nalco had provided detailed and fulsome disclosure, annexing all relevant internal correspondence. Their Honours did not agree that Cytec’s criticisms (failure to call one inventor, filing late lay evidence after Cytec objected to hearsay, adducing voluminous documents) established a material failure of disclosure.
- Re-litigation: Justices Beach and Jackman also rejected Cytec’s argument that the amendment application was impermissible re-litigation. Nalco was seeking to address by means of the amendments sought Justice Burley’s findings in the Substantive Decision that were based on his Honour’s conclusion as to construction. Their Honour’s considered that section 105(1A) of the Act was enacted to overcome the difficulty of amending a patent application in the context of an appeal from the Commissioner’s decision.
- Other discretionary factors: Finally, Justices Beach and Jackman did not consider the amendments to be futile or an abuse of monopoly (given the patent had not been granted).
Justices Beach and Jackman accordingly exercised the discretion in Nalco’s favour and allowed the amendments.
Outcome
The key outcomes were:
- Leave to appeal was granted in respect of both the Substantive and Amendment Decisions, with the appeal on the Substantive Decision then being dismissed and the appeal on the Amended Decision then being allowed.
- Justice Burley’s order refusing the amendment application was set aside, and Nalco’s amendment application was granted.
- Australian patent application no 2012220990 is to proceed to grant in the amended form.
Implications
- Claim construction in chemistry patents: The decision reinforces that claims will be given their ordinary meaning even where a particular embodiment within their scope is chemically near-impossible. Patentees must take care to draft claims that are limited to what the specification actually teaches, rather than claims whose breadth (even if theoretically very narrow in practice) outruns the disclosure.
- The interplay between ss 40(2)(a) and 40(3): The decision confirms that where a claim’s scope includes an embodiment for which no method of performance is disclosed, the claim will fail both the support and enablement requirements, regardless of whether that embodiment is practically achievable.
- Scope of s 105(1A): The decision provides important guidance on the breadth of the Court’s power and discretion to allow amendments to a patent application during an appeal from a Commissioner’s opposition decision. It confirms that: (a) s 105(1A) is designed to allow a patent applicant to address invalidity findings made during appeal proceedings, not merely pre-existing invalidity risks; (b) the discretionary factors applicable to amendments of granted patents under s 105(1) do not translate directly to s 105(1A) given the different context (no monopoly yet conferred, no abuse of monopoly possible); and (c) the Court will not treat an amendment application as impermissible re-litigation merely because it arises from adverse findings in the same appeal.
- Delay: The decision clarifies that the relevant clock for unreasonable delay in an amendment application under s 105(1A) runs from the time the applicant has (or ought to have had) knowledge of the specific invalidity ground requiring amendment — not from awareness of general vulnerability in the specification. Where an opposing party significantly reformulates its case on the eve of trial, the patent applicant will not ordinarily be penalised for failing to pre-emptively address the reformulated ground.
